How Outpatient Drug and Alcohol Treatment Works in Manton, Michigan

If you have been battling with a severe substance use disorder and addiction, outpatient drug rehabilitation may not prove useful for you. Before you look for treatment for your substance abuse, you must first go through detox to rid your body completely of the substances you were abusing.

After the detox stage, the outp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ation program will begin the official work of therapy and recovery. In fact, these programs work best if you have already completed another form of rehab - such as a participating in an inp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ation program. You should also be deemed medically stable enough that you can easily pursue treatment and recovery with minimal supervision.

When you enroll in an outpatient alcohol and drug rehab in Manton, the following services will be provided every week:

  • Counseling with Family
  • Group therapy and individual meetings for support and encouragement
  • Individual therapy and counseling
  • Medication management, which might be required if you have a co-occurring disorder or have been diagnosed with polysubstance addiction
  • Nutritional coaching
  • One to one counseling and therapy with trained addiction treatment and/or mental health expert
  • Recreational therapy
  • Training in relapse prevention techniques
  • Transitional living

Since outpatient rehab does not demand that you live inside the facility, it means that you may need to dedicate yourself to recovery so that the program proves successful in the long run. You should also aim for sobriety and abstain from drugs without any monitoring or care.

As long as your surroundings are conducive to your recovery, you may find that outpatient drug and alcohol treatment is the best option. This is because you will receive help and assistance at home so that you can continue focusing on beating your addiction - with none of the temptations you might have run into in the past.
